We've (me and my 10 and 14 year olds) just come back from an 11 night holiday in Costa Rica. We booked through Families Worldwide. I've seen them mentioned a handful of times on here but they don't have many reviews online so I have to admit I was a little nervous before we left. So, I thought I'd do a quick post about my experience in case it helps someone else.
Basically, they were really good! Their group tour dates didn't work for us so we did a tailor made holiday. The good thing there was we had full control over the itinerary although it meant using shared transfers and not having a dedicated guide. The itinerary they developed for us was great, we loved everything we did. The transfers all worked perfectly and the various tour companies they booked for excursions were really good.
We could have done things cheaper if we booked everything ourselves, but having them do it saved so much effort. It also meant they could make some last minute changes for us, and they also covered a couple of room/hotel upgrade costs (one due to availability, the other because our consultant realised our hotel in San JosΓ© wasn't in the best location so changed it for us at their cost). And, as a solo adult with children, I had one point of contact should anything untoward happen.
